What is the Oregon Industrial Property Return?
The Oregon Industrial Property Return is an essential form for taxpayers in Oregon to report and adjust the valuation of their real and personal property. This form serves as a crucial tool in maintaining accurate property assessments, allowing taxpayers to communicate changes in property value to the Oregon tax authorities.
This form requires completion and signing by the taxpayer, ensuring that the information provided is accurate and reliable. The requirements for accurate completion include a cover sheet detailing the company’s information and various schedules for each property account.
